F3599

Standard Guide for Aerospace/Aviation Powerplant Personnel Certification

active, Most Current
Publication Date: 1 September 2023
Status: active
Page Count: 9
ICS Code (Aerospace engines and propulsion systems): 49.050
ICS Code (Aircraft and space vehicles in general): 49.020
scope:

The purpose of this guide is to address the basic fundamental subject knowledge, task performance, and task knowledge activities and functions for power plants professionals.
